Description
An improper authentication vulnerability in CA Privileged Access Manager 3.x Web-UI jk-manager and jk-status allows a remote attacker to gain sensitive information or alter configuration.

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Broadcom | Privileged Access Manager | >= 3.0.1, <= 3.0.3 |
| Broadcom | Privileged Access Manager | >= 3.1.1, <= 3.1.2 |
| Broadcom | Privileged Access Manager | >= 3.2.0, <= 3.2.1 |
